Output e8261a21c79d6d728d111fce40e276ab6c9a8e8c03867b0f2123c09b4df2933d:171

value
73685912
script pubkey
OP_0 OP_PUSHBYTES_20 e3f1e1484d3db4eb9bad6dbc5d1dd05a1f1db49d
address
bc1qu0c7zjzd8k6whxaddk7968wstg03mdya0cvu0k
transaction
e8261a21c79d6d728d111fce40e276ab6c9a8e8c03867b0f2123c09b4df2933d